Southeastern Columbia, located between Fort Jackson and Congaree National Park, is a residential and outdoorsy Columbia neighborhood with a riverine landscape and long, wooded corridors.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the Garners Ferry Rd and Leesburg Rd junction, where strip plazas, local eateries, and service storefronts set a steady, everyday rhythm. Pillars include the South Carolina State Farmers Market, the McKissick Museum at the University of South Carolina, and the Township Auditorium for live shows. Housing ranges from mid-century ranches to newer subdivisions, often on generous lots. Green space and water define the geography, with trails and floodplain forests nearby. Commutes and errands tend to follow the Garners Ferry spine toward downtown.
